Output eb35a6ba020500774c96c0f08391f38ab5837ccc3216d42db90fa5467551362e:11

value
21118748
script pubkey
OP_0 OP_PUSHBYTES_20 8d929d0147573996ebd1f110f23f3beb60dc7418
address
ltc1q3kff6q282uued6737yg0y0emadsdcaqcckgztw
transaction
eb35a6ba020500774c96c0f08391f38ab5837ccc3216d42db90fa5467551362e
spent
true